Purpose:
The Health & Safety Engineer is responsible for supporting the business units on all issues relating to occupational safety, health protection and accident prevention.
- Fulfilment of all tasks according to §6 ASiG in a biochemical / biological manufacturing facility.
- Implementation, management and monitoring of HS programs, policies, and procedures to ensure compliance to German legislation and Meridians HS standards and guidelines.
- Evaluation of the organization's procedures, facilities, and equipment by conducting inspections to identify unsafe conditions and to implement safeguards and solutions
- Completion and further development of risk assessments according to ArbSchG and BetrSichV
- Creation, updating and maintenance of operating and work instructions based on risk assessments
- Designing workplaces and work processes to achieve efficient ergonomics
- Creation, review, up-date and control of the companies SDS in accordance with GHS
- Identifying and assessing work-related accident and health hazards and health promotion factors
- Collaborate with employees and supervisors to identify and mitigate HS risks.
- Continuously improving the safety and health of all employees and up-dating the HS system
- Training and coaching of employees, supervisor, and safety officers to continuously improve HS performance
- Maintaining a thorough up to date knowledge of relevant laws, standards and regulations that impacts or may impact Meridian business
